Miss X complained about the Council’s handling of her child’s Education, Health and Care needs assessment. We found the Council at fault for significant delays, poor communication, and poor administrative practice. These faults resulted in missed special educational provision for her child and caused Miss X avoidable distress and uncertainty. The Council has agreed to apologise and make a payment to Miss X.
